How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Twelve Oaks?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Twelve Oaks Studio Apartments | $1,596 | $1,375 | $2,399 |
| Twelve Oaks 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,990 | $1,198 | $10,000+ |
| Twelve Oaks 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,230 | $1,240 | $10,000+ |
| Twelve Oaks 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,399 | $1,794 | $10,000+ |
| Twelve Oaks 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,979 | $3,979 | $3,979 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Short-term Twelve Oaks Apartments
What is the Cheapest Short-term apartment in Twelve Oaks?
Currently the most affordable Short-term Apartment in Twelve Oaks is at RIATA APARTMENTS listed at $1,250.
How much is the average rent for a Short-term Twelve Oaks Apartment?
The average rent for a Short-term Apartment in Twelve Oaks is $2,386.
What is the largest Short-term Twelve Oaks Apartment for rent?
Today's Short-term apartment with the most square footage in Twelve Oaks is a 2,464 square feet unit starting from $3,979 at 1859 E La Vieve Ln.
What is the average size for Twelve Oaks Short-term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Short-term rental in Twelve Oaks is currently at 915 sq ft.
